Women of Worth
Mondays 9:30 a.m.- lead by Lynette Hardy
Women of Worth meet from September-May observing all school holidays & closings.
WOW (Women of Worth) is a weekly Bible study for women with a combination of fellowship, small group time, homework and lectures. It begins again in the Fall on Monday, September 8th from 9:30 to 11:30 a.m. in the Upper Room. WOW is open to all women of the Kirk of all ages and all women in the community. We encourage you to invite your friends, family, co-workers and neighbors for this amazing Bible Study.
The title of this year’s WOW is “Footprints: Passing on a spiritual Legacy from Generation to Generation.” “Footprints” will help every woman discover how our lives can affect our world around us and leave a legacy for future generations.
